Deh Posted April 28, 2017 Posted April 28, 2017 Hi all. I'm eligible to apply from the 457 to 186 visa however our accountant is holding me back as he is yet to finish the 2016 financials. Cutting long story short I would like to know if it's possible to consider the training benchmark as a cumulative figure or if it has to be year by year.For example: if 1% our payroll it's 20,000 and we have spent $50,000 on apprentice's wages on the second year can the balance counts towards the third year?Appreciate if anyone can shed a light. MaggieMay24 Posted April 29, 2017 Posted April 29, 2017 According to what's posted on the DIBP website for employers: " You must have met the subclass 457 visa training requirements in each year you have been a standard business sponsor." So I would assume they cannot carry wages forward from one year to the next.
